Seoul: A Symphony of Modernity and Tradition

My adventure began in Seoul, a city that seamlessly blends the ancient with the ultra-modern. The vibrant energy is palpable – a captivating mix of neon lights, bustling markets, and ancient palaces. One moment you're lost in the tranquil beauty of Gyeongbokgung Palace, the largest of Seoul's five grand palaces, marveling at its intricate architecture and serene courtyards. The next, you're immersed in the trendy shops and cafes of Gangnam, a district known for its upscale boutiques and pulsating nightlife. Don't miss the chance to explore the colorful and charming Bukchon Hanok Village, with its traditional Korean houses, offering a glimpse into Seoul's rich history.

Beyond Seoul: Discovering Korea's Hidden Gems

While Seoul is undoubtedly a highlight, venturing beyond the capital reveals a wealth of hidden gems. The UNESCO World Heritage site of Bulguksa Temple in Gyeongju, a city steeped in history, showcases the country's remarkable architectural prowess. The intricate carvings and serene atmosphere are truly awe-inspiring. Nearby, the Seokguram Grotto, a stunning cave temple housing a massive Buddha statue, offers a moment of spiritual reflection. The stunning beauty and historical significance of these sites are unforgettable.

Jeju Island: Volcanic Beauty and Coastal Charms

A trip to Korea wouldn't be complete without exploring the volcanic paradise of Jeju Island. This picturesque island boasts dramatic cliffs, stunning beaches, and lush landscapes. The Seongsan Ilchulbong Peak (Sunrise Peak), a UNESCO World Heritage site, offers breathtaking panoramic views of the coastline. The Manjanggul Lava Tube, a mesmerizing volcanic cave, is another must-see, allowing you to explore the fascinating geological wonders of the island. For relaxation, head to one of Jeju's many pristine beaches, perfect for swimming, sunbathing, or simply enjoying the tranquility of the ocean.

Busan: A Coastal City with a Vibrant Culture

Busan, South Korea's second-largest city, is a vibrant coastal metropolis with a distinct character. Explore the bustling Jagalchi Fish Market, where you can witness the energy of the fishing industry and sample fresh seafood delicacies. Gamcheon Culture Village, with its colorful houses cascading down the hillside, offers a unique and Instagram-worthy experience. And for a relaxing escape, head to Haeundae Beach, one of Busan's most popular stretches of sand.
